React Native:如何获取存储在设备本机Music应用中的可用音频文件和播放列表的列表?

时间:2018-12-17 01:43:57

标签: android ios react-native

我想在正在开发的应用程序中构建音乐播放器,并尝试找出如何从移动设备的“音乐”应用程序播放文件和播放列表。在我的应用中,我需要能够根据磁力计和加速度计等信号控制播放和播放音量。

例如,在使用iOS的情况下,我试图避免让用户直接将文件上传到我的应用程序沙箱中。

我发现https://github.com/react-native-kit/react-native-track-player允许我播放很棒的文件网址

我的问题是我无法确定如何获取“音乐”应用程序下已保存到设备的文件URL和播放列表的列表。

我希望能够以跨平台的方式进行操作。我一直在搜索数小时,但似乎没有有关如何执行此类操作的信息。

这甚至可能吗?还是我必须使用我的应用程序沙箱创建自己的播放列表音频文件管理系统?

任何帮助或建议的指导表示赞赏。

更新

我发现了https://github.com/cinder92/react-native-get-music-files,但是它似乎没有提供路径信息,因此我无法在轨迹播放器中播放文件。

0 个答案:

没有答案